descriptive statistics - correct answer ✔✔collecting organizing and presenting the data
inferential statistics - correct answer ✔✔drawing conclusions about a population based on sample data
from that population
parameter - correct answer ✔✔is a number used to describe a population
statistic - correct answer ✔✔a number calculated from a sample and is used to estimate the parameter

data lake - correct answer ✔✔stores structured, semi-structured, and unstructured raw data
, data warehouse - correct answer ✔✔stores structured data that is ready for data analytics - a business
professional would look at this data

quantitative variables - correct answer ✔✔have a numerical value that works like a number
qualitative variables - correct answer ✔✔do not have a meaningful numerical value; aka categorical
variables

discrete - correct answer ✔✔there are jumps between possible values
continuous - correct answer ✔✔there is another possible value between any two values
